Segels investment philosophy is rooted in the time-tested principles of value investing, a strategy popularized by legends like Warren Buffett and Benjamin Graham. This approach involves looking for companies that are undervalued by the market, have a durable competitive advantage, and are managed by competent and honest leaders. Segel is known for his meticulous research, digging into financial statements, understanding a company's true intrinsic value, and having the conviction to hold onto investments for the long term, weathering michael lund petersen net worth market volatility without panic. This contrasts sharply with the short-termism that plagues many modern markets, where stock prices can swing wildly based on quarterly earnings reports or social media trends. By focusing on the underlying business fundamentals, Segel has been able to build a portfolio of high-quality assets that generate consistent returns, compounding his net worth over time. His Minimum holding period for a investment is often measured in years, not months, a mindset that has proven incredibly lucrative.
